Producer Summary:Santa Carolina, founded in 1875 and currently owned by the Larrain family, proudly champions Chilean Heritage with a focus on innovation. Through the journey of the valleys, Santa Carolina respects each varietals typicity and treasures the expression of fruit. The estates, owned and managed by Santa Carolina, are located in Maipo, Rapel, Leyda, Casablanca and Colchagua.

Long Tasting Note:Elegant, complex and smooth, this medium bodied wine has strawberry and redcurrant fruit flavours with a touch of white pepper and a soft, lingering finish. The grapes were grown in the Casablanca Valley, a region renowned for making excellent cool climate wines. The Pacific Ocean brings morning fogs and cool afternoon breezes that moderate the valley temperatures and humidity, allowing the grapes to slowly ripen and develop complex flavours. The wine was then aged for six months in French oak barrels and is left to mature for one year brior to bottling. This wine is a good match with grilled tuna and roast beef.
